Wireless sensor field enumeration
First Claim
Patent Images
1. A system for authenticating data provided by a network of multiple sensors and providing an authenticated presentation of the data, the system comprising:
- an authentication server configured to;
authenticate the multiple sensors and data provided by the multiple sensors;
store the data in a database;
authenticate a data requester before providing requested data from the database;
a presentation server configured to;
authenticate an analysis requester requesting an analysis of at least some of the data stored in the database; and
authenticate an analyst selected by the analysis requester to perform the analysis,wherein the presentation server requests for the analyst access to the at least some of the data stored in the database from the authentication server;
a permanently established gateway having final routing information for routing data aggregated from the network of sensors to the authentication server; and
multiple mobile gateways, wherein each of the mobile gateways is configured to aggregate data from the network of sensors, and wherein each of the mobile gateways includes a routing table for routing the aggregated data among the multiple mobile gateways to the permanently established gateway.
1 Assignment
0 Petitions
Accused Products
Abstract
A system for authenticating data acquired by multiple sensors prior to storing the data in a database is described. The system also authenticates users requesting data access and intelligence agents that provide analyses of data stored in the database. As a result, any data or data analysis obtained from the system is traceable and reliable.
-
Citations
19 Claims
-
1. A system for authenticating data provided by a network of multiple sensors and providing an authenticated presentation of the data, the system comprising:
-
an authentication server configured to; authenticate the multiple sensors and data provided by the multiple sensors; store the data in a database; authenticate a data requester before providing requested data from the database; a presentation server configured to; authenticate an analysis requester requesting an analysis of at least some of the data stored in the database; and authenticate an analyst selected by the analysis requester to perform the analysis, wherein the presentation server requests for the analyst access to the at least some of the data stored in the database from the authentication server; a permanently established gateway having final routing information for routing data aggregated from the network of sensors to the authentication server; and multiple mobile gateways, wherein each of the mobile gateways is configured to aggregate data from the network of sensors, and wherein each of the mobile gateways includes a routing table for routing the aggregated data among the multiple mobile gateways to the permanently established gateway.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A system for authenticating data provided by a network of multiple sensors and providing an authenticated presentation of the data, the system comprising:
-
a permanently established gateway that stores final routing information for routing data aggregated from the network of sensors to an authentication server, and further stores sensor information about which sensors are registered and a type of data which each registered sensor is permitted to store in a database, wherein the permanently established gateway is configured to authenticate the sensor and the data provided by the sensor; multiple mobile gateways, wherein each of the mobile gateways is configured to aggregate data from the network of sensors, and wherein each of the mobile gateways includes a routing table for routing the aggregated data among the multiple gateways to the permanently established gateway; wherein the authentication server configured to; authenticate the permanently established gateway; receive the data from the permanently established gateway; store the data in the database; and authenticate a data requester before providing requested data from the database; and a presentation server configured to; authenticate an analysis requester requesting an analysis of at least some of the data stored in the database; and
,authenticate an analyst selected by the analysis requester to perform the analysis, wherein the presentation server requests for the analyst access to the at least some of the data stored in the database from the authentication server. - View Dependent Claims (10, 11, 12, 13)
-
-
14. A computer-implemented method comprising:
-
receiving, at an authentication server, data from one or more sensors; authenticating, at the authentication server, the one or more sensors and the received data prior to storing the received data in a database; receiving, at a presentation server, a request from an analysis requester for an analysis of at least some of the stored data; authenticating, at the presentation server, the analysis requester; authenticating, at the presentation server, an analyst selected by the analysis requester to perform the analysis; storing, at a permanently established gateway, final routing information for routing data aggregated from the network of sensors to the authentication server; aggregating data from the network of sensors to multiple mobile gateways, wherein each of the mobile gateways includes a routing table for routing the aggregated data among the multiple mobile gateways to the permanently established gateway; and providing access to the at least some of the stored data to the analyst, wherein at least one of the analysis requester and the analyst is authorized to access the at least some of the stored data. - View Dependent Claims (15, 16, 17, 18, 19)
-
Specification